January 05, 2006
This is a critical update to a Windows security flaw. Most people should simply run Windows Update (in Internet Explorer, see the menu Tools, Windows Update). That's the easiest way to update. If you want, you can read the info at the following link; there is a downloadable update, but I still recommend Windows Update.
Microsoft Security Bulletin MS06-001
Vulnerability in Graphics Rendering Engine Could Allow Remote Code Execution (912919)
Published: January 5, 2006
Version: 1.0
Summary
Who should read this document: Customers who use Microsoft Windows
Impact of Vulnerability: Remote Code Execution
Maximum Severity Rating: Critical
Recommendation: Customers should apply the update immediately.
